Output e77e689c2b1fd67807bebd5b4d6c3d54f6d22096f3f6ca57ec1506cdf21375ae:8

value
70685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 524dce71b1950b91996b0ba520bb771e1b45f1c5 OP_EQUAL
address
39CCYMmQwBRw76LHLxuZMNcHzCNZ7Q8RAL
transaction
e77e689c2b1fd67807bebd5b4d6c3d54f6d22096f3f6ca57ec1506cdf21375ae